I recommend going roller. It's too easy with today's oils to wipe the cam lobes, even if you do everything right. Ask me how I know. Link bar rollers or a dog bone conversion with a small base circle cam - either works. A little more expensive than the flat tappet up front but it's a lot cheaper than a rebuild.
